在线教育平台搭建有哪些步骤?
在当今信息化时代,在线教育平台已经成为人们获取知识、提升技能的重要途径。搭建一个功能完善、用户体验良好的在线教育平台,需要遵循一定的步骤。以下将详细介绍在线教育平台搭建的步骤。
一、需求分析与规划
在搭建在线教育平台之前,首先要明确平台的目标用户、课程类型、功能需求等。这一步骤至关重要,因为它将直接影响到后续的开发与运营。
- 目标用户分析:了解用户的基本信息、学习需求、兴趣爱好等,以便后续设计符合用户需求的课程内容。
- 课程类型规划:根据目标用户的需求,规划适合的课程类型,如学历教育、职业技能培训、兴趣爱好等。
- 功能需求分析:确定平台所需的基本功能,如课程管理、用户管理、在线直播、作业提交、互动交流等。
二、平台架构设计
平台架构设计是搭建在线教育平台的关键环节,它决定了平台的性能、稳定性、扩展性等。
- 技术选型:根据需求分析,选择合适的技术框架和开发语言,如Java、PHP、Python等。
- 数据库设计:设计合理的数据库结构,确保数据存储的安全性、可靠性。
- 服务器配置:选择合适的云服务器或物理服务器,确保平台的高可用性和稳定性。
三、平台功能开发
在完成平台架构设计后,进入功能开发阶段。这一阶段需要按照需求分析中的功能需求进行开发。
- 前端开发:设计美观、易用的用户界面,提高用户体验。
- 后端开发:实现课程管理、用户管理、在线直播、作业提交、互动交流等功能。
- 接口开发:开发API接口,方便第三方应用接入。
四、平台测试与优化
平台开发完成后,需要进行严格的测试,确保平台功能的稳定性和安全性。
- 功能测试:验证平台各项功能是否按预期工作。
- 性能测试:评估平台在高并发情况下的性能表现。
- 安全测试:确保平台的安全性,防止数据泄露和恶意攻击。
五、平台上线与运营
平台上线后,需要进行持续的运营和维护,以提高用户满意度和市场竞争力。
- 内容运营:定期更新课程内容,满足用户需求。
- 用户运营:通过活动、优惠等方式吸引用户,提高用户活跃度。
- 数据分析:分析用户行为数据,优化平台功能和运营策略。
案例分析:
以某知名在线教育平台为例,该平台在搭建过程中,充分分析了目标用户的需求,采用了成熟的技术框架和开发语言,实现了课程管理、用户管理、在线直播等功能。同时,平台注重用户体验,设计了美观、易用的界面,并进行了严格的测试,确保了平台的稳定性和安全性。经过几年的运营,该平台已成为国内领先的在线教育平台之一。
总之,搭建一个在线教育平台需要遵循一定的步骤,从需求分析、平台架构设计、功能开发到上线运营,每个环节都需要精心策划和实施。只有不断完善和优化,才能在激烈的市场竞争中脱颖而出。
猜你喜欢:即时通讯出海